Vista is a brand new release of Microsoft Windows. You 'should have' the latest hardware (new powerful computer) to take advantage of all the features. Also, not all applications are compatible with Vista yet.

XP has been out for years, and is mostly rock solid. If you dont have a NEED for Vista, then stay with XP for a while until the bugs are worked out of Vista.
